George Frideric Handel is best known for his oratorio "Messiah," particularly the "Hallelujah" chorus, which remains one of the most celebrated pieces in choral music. Other significant works include the Opera "Giulio Cesare," the orchestral suite "Water Music," and the "Music for the Royal Fireworks." Handel's compositions are characterized by their rich melodies and intricate counterpoint, blending elements of both Italian opera and English choral traditions.
